A first time comprehensive album presenting the marvelous collection of the sacred relics at Topkapi Palace Museum, Istanbul. The collection includes hundreds of invaluable belongings of Prophets such as Abraham, Moses, and Muhammad as well as Prophet Muhammad’s Companions and a number of Muslim saints. Excavated from the most restricted rooms of the palace, the entire selection is compiled here for the first time, including those that are not on exhibit for daily visits.

Hilmi Aydin

Hilmi Aydin was born in Kars in 1963. In 1986 he graduated from Istanbul University from the department of art history. He did his master's degree about depictions of Topkapi Palace on engravings and artwork. In 1988, he began working at the Istanbul Mimar Sinan University in the Sculpture and Arts Museum. Since 1997 he is the vice president at Topkapi Palace in the department of Arms and Sacred Trusts. He has written over fifty research articles for different cultural and historical magazines. He has also made presentations about art history at different seminars.
